this evening i set up my "poor mans 3d"(a cardboard cutout of a buck!) with my bag behind it. i walk all arond the yard shooting from all over at unknown distances. although its my yard and i have out to 40yds marked..i still dont know the diffrent angles and yardages. i was hiding behind the trees..hunkering down below low limbs...shooting through the abandoned BIG wooden swingset/slide/sandbox etc..it was good practice. next weekend or so my buddy and i are hoping to meet schedules and set up a stand in the woods and shoot his 3d from it while the guy on the ground moves it around. next year i plan to hit all the 3ds i can find and have time to shoot. i think they would be fun and pretty decint practice. thats my biggest fear is missing or worse..wounding a deer because i misjudged distance. i THINK im ok...but im definently going to practice that more before season. id like to own a range finder someday..since i gota count points and all.....thats another thing...i gotta count to 4 before releasing...i hope i can do that..judge the distance and make the shot before my chance passes!...itll be an interesting year....but im going to give it my all.....
